Profile

Mark W. Malzahn is certified by the Minnesota State Bar Association as a civil trial specialist. This prestigious designation is maintained by less than 2 percent of all Minnesota attorneys. Located in Anoka, his law firm, Malzahn Law, Ltd., provides strong personal injury representation to clients throughout the Twin Cities and the western suburbs of St. Paul and Minneapolis.

For more than 25 years, Mr. Malzahn has been helping personal injury victims and their families aggressively pursue compensation from large insurance companies and corporations. He handles cases involving wrongful death, car accidents, truck accidents, dog bites, premises liability, brain injuries and other serious injuries.

In 1983, Mr. Malzahn graduated with his J.D. from Hamline University School of Law in St. Paul, Minnesota. He is a panel arbitrator with the American Arbitration Association and a member of the American Association for Justice, the Minnesota Association for Justice, the American Bar Association, the Wisconsin State Bar Association and the Minnesota State Bar Association.

In addition, Mr. Malzahn is a former district ethics investigator, an interstate trucking litigation committee member and a certified neutral mediator.
